Double Glazing Lock Repairs Quality locks on your windows and doors will stop burglars from entering your home They usually dont want to break glass or attempt to squeeze through open windows However some doubleglazing owners have encountered issues with their door or window lock after its been installed Fortunately these issues can be fixed without having to purchase new double glazing Broken or damaged locks A locksmith can fix your uPVC window or door lock if damaged or broken They can repair hinges striker plates and locks for your double glazing They can also reposition the cylinder to correct any misalignment that may cause your handle to function properly The mechanism could be seized when the key is inserted into the lock but it does not turn or be difficult to insert Dirt or grease can be trapped in the mechanism If this is the case it could be possible for the lock to be cleaned and lubricated Make use of a dry lubricant such as graphite or teflon not oil because oil can attract dirt and cause it to stick to the mechanisms inside After lubricating insert the key into the lock and turn it The lubricant must work its way into the mechanism and the lock should turn easily A faulty lock can also be caused by loose screws within the mechanism of the lock They can become loose and fall out or even break completely preventing the lock to function properly A screwdriver is a tool to tighten the screws however caution must be taken not to overtighten them as this can cause damage to internal components A damaged lock could be dangerous for both you and your family particularly if you have young children They can open the door without your knowledge and gain access to your home If youre worried about the possibility that this could occur a licensed
